Campbell University is a beautiful, residential campus in the Cape Fear region of North Carolina set on 850 acres in the community of Buies Creek. The campus is located 28 miles north of Fayetteville and 30 miles south of Raleigh- the capital city.
Campbell University is private university of the liberal arts, sciences and professions affiliated with the Baptist State Convention of North Carolina. The university is comprised of the College of Arts and Sciences, Lundy-Fetterman School of Business, School of Education, Norman A. Wiggins School of Law, School of Pharmacy and the Divinity School. Campbell is also recognized as a Servicemembers Opportunity College.
